Makes 10 servings, 1/2 cup each.
Heat oven to 350°F.
Add beans to large saucepan of boiling water; cook on medium heat 4 to 6 min. or until crisp-tender. Rinse with cold water; drain.
Cook bacon in same saucepan on medium heat until crisp. Remove bacon from skillet with slotted spoon; drain on paper towels. Discard all but 2 Tbsp. drippings from skillet. Add onions to reserved drippings; cook and stir 4 min. or until tender. Stir in flour. Gradually stir in milk until well blended; cook and stir 3 min. or until thickened. Add cheese; cook and stir 3 min. or until melted.
Stir in beans and bacon; spoon into 1-1/2-qt. casserole sprayed with cooking spray. Top with cracker crumbs.
Bake 25 min. or until heated through.
